Lee County School District
Percent of high school students who met the ACT benchmarks for English (18) or reading (22) and for math (22), or earn a Silver ACT WorkKeys Certificate with a CTE pathway completion or industry certification, or a Gold or Platinum WorkKeys Certificate.
Small groups are not displayed to protect student privacy. See User Guide for more information.
Group | District | State |
---|---|---|
All | 49.6% | 53.5% |
Female | 55.2% | 54.9% |
Male | 56.9% | 52.0% |
Black or African American | 27.9% | 36.0% |
White | 69.8% | 72.4% |
Hispanic or Latino | 43.3% | 53.7% |
Two or More Races | 63.6% | 52.5% |
Economically Disadvantaged | 37.7% | 42.2% |
Non Economically Disadvantaged | 66.7% | 68.8% |
Students with Disabilities | 16.1% | 23.5% |
Students without Disabilities | 59.5% | 56.3% |
Non English Learners | 56.1% | 53.9% |
